0.7 INTENDED RECIPIENTS OF THE INSTRUCTION MANUAL
This manual is intended for:
The operator
- understood as the person responsible for operating, adjusting, cleaning, and performing routine maintenance on the machine.
Skilled personnel or skilled operator
- understood as those individuals who have attended specialization courses, training, etc. and have
experience in installation, commissioning and maintenance, repairs, and transport of the machine.
Exposed individuals
- understood as those individuals whose presence inside and/or near a machine is a risk to their own health or safety.
Qualifications of the intended recipient
The machine is intended for professional and not general use and therefore its use may only be entrusted to qualified individuals who, in
particular:
1.
Are legal adults;
2.
Are physically and mentally fit to perform operations of particular technical difficulty;
3.
Have been adequately trained in operating and maintaining the machine;
4.
Are considered by their employer suitable to perform the task they have been assigned;
5.
Are capable of understanding and interpreting the operator manual and safety precautions;
6.
Are knowledgeable of the emergency procedures and how to implement them;
7.
Have the ability to use the specific type of equipment;
8.
Are familiar with the specific applicable regulations;
9.
Have understood the operating procedures defined by the manufacturer of the machine.

0.8.1 GLOSSARY
MACHINE
: in this manual, machine refers to the hydraulic magnet pursuant to Directive 2006/42/EC.
DANGER ZONE
:
any area inside and/or near a machine in which the presence of a person constitutes a risk to the safety and health of said person
(Annex i, 1.1.1 Directive 2006/42/EC)
EXPOSED PERSON
:
any person who is found partially or entirely in a danger zone
